Hook it … WebEspecially in newer homes, the base of the cabinets themselves are plywood, which means you have anywhere between 1/8 to 1/4 inch of actual finish-able wood until you sand through. You can still sand the plywood, but it can be easy to sand through, and if you're not willing to take that risk, I'd go with paint. WebSep 6, 2024 · Buy it: INSL-X Prime Lock, $39 for 1 gallon. While priming can add a day to the process, because you have to wait for it to dry before you can paint, the step is totally necessary. “Skipping primer is not an option,” says Lexi. After priming, they typically sand the primer layer before painting the wood in order rough up the surface even ... WebNov 27, 2024 · The other important thing to remember is to use an oil-based primer. Due to the more porous nature of MDF, water-based primers can swell the surface. Use an oil-based primer for the first coat, then paint the kitchen cabinets with water-based latex paint without worrying about moisture absorption.
